Output ef2b39a8e5f93876714cdc859880903fe11d94419f591d6bc403c96ca3c5fe1b:92

value
11626
script pubkey
OP_0 OP_PUSHBYTES_20 e51a6c91f3e54dc3a44dc7384a7d5c434c01c7e9
address
bc1qu5dxey0nu4xu8fzdcuuy5l2ugdxqr3lftnugp4
transaction
ef2b39a8e5f93876714cdc859880903fe11d94419f591d6bc403c96ca3c5fe1b
confirmations
9434
spent
true